Memera consumer units just got even better
Story
The feature-packed MEM Memera Consumer Unit range has been redesigned and expanded. It now includes units developed specifically to overcome problems faced by installers endeavouring to meet the requirements of the 17th Edition of the IEE Wiring Regulations (BS 7671), in particular the need for more wiring space when units are fitted with RCBO protection of individual outgoing circuits.
Features of the new range include:-
- * A new 11-way unit designed specifically for RCBO protection of outgoing ways
* Moulded and metal enclosures with up to 19 and 38 outgoing ways respectively
* New 1-way and 2/3-way consumer units
* A new 80A + 63A dual-RCD option
* Type B or Type C MCBs and RCBOs
* An option for protective and control devices to be factory-fitted
Electrical contractors have found that conventional consumer units do not allow enough space for wiring when RCBOs are fitted instead of MCBs to protect individual outgoing circuits. The range now includes an 11-way consumer unit designed specifically to take RCBOs and yet allow generous space for wiring above the devices. Individual RCBOs offer the highest possible level of personal protection demanded by BS 7671.
Other advanced features that have long distinguished the Memera 2000AD units are retained. These include the unique snappable busbar that allows on-site configuration of split-load units, a removable pan assembly that simplifies installation, and extremely flexible cut-out provision for cable entry in the rear of the moulded units.
The new units offer DP isolator or RCD incoming main switch options. Versions are available to satisfy the many configurations required to enable an installer to comply with the personal protection requirements of the 17th Edition of the IEE Wiring Regulations.
They include isolator-controlled single and dual RCD units, dual RCD variable split-load boards and the new 11-way RCBO board. In addition to the existing dual RCD split-load arrangement with two 80A RCDs, there is a cost-effective alternative with one 80A RCD and one 63A RCD. At the smaller end of the range are new one-way and 2/3-way units suitable for extensions and additions to existing installations, garages and outbuildings.
The moulded units are available with up to 19 outgoing ways, as with the existing Memera range, to cope with modern requirements for more circuits and/or special control and command devices. If more ways are required, two units can be linked together by means of AD coupling kits. Metal consumer units are available for surface or flush mounting and include dual-rail units offering up to 38 outgoing ways, as well as multiple RCD split-load units and dual/multi tariff arrangements.
The new range of outgoing devices includes single-module miniature circuit-breakers (MCBs) up to 63A and single-module RCBOs (combined MCBs and RCDs) up to 45A. In addition to the standard Type B devices, Type C MCBs and RCBOs are also available for applications involving high inrush currents, such as some lighting loads, which are prone to cause nuisance tripping with some Type B devices. The offering also includes a full range of control and command accessories including timers, relays and contactors.
The new MEM Memera consumer unit range supersedes the Memera 2000 and 2000AD ranges. Devices will continue to be available to fit these units for the foreseeable future.

Fire Glazing For Southampton University
Story
Building 85 lies within the campus of Southampton University, and is the new home for the Institute of Life Sciences. This new, state of the art building cost in the region of £34 million to construct, and core to the design was the use of sustainable and low maintenance materials, a category which included fire glazing systems from Fendor.
Over 40 different fire glazing elements were required for the interior of the building, ranging from screens, doors and panels offering 30 minutes fire rating in the atrium to 60 minute fire rated doors and screens in the lift lobby. Architects NBBJ of London were responsible for the design and according to project architect, Crysta Falcon, the Fendor Fireline system was the best option in terms of performance, appearance and sustainability.
“We chose the Fireline system because of its proven ability to offer the required fire rating, and due to its fire performance without having to compromise aesthetics in the ten metre atrium, ” she commented. “The whole theme of the building raises the bar in terms of design sustainability, with timber featuring heavily both internally and externally.
The cladding is Western Red Cedar and the internal panelling is bamboo. The door and joinery features are also timber and the steel Fireline system was the ideal complement to the wood detailing. Polyester powder coated finished, the fire glazed elements offer very low maintenance, significantly reducing the need for repainting and redecoration.”
The Fireline range of fire resistant glazing meets all legislative and safety requirements for fire integrity and fire insulation, and offers natural light into buildings whilst still performing its primary function. This enables it to be used as a design medium in its own right, as is the case at Building 85 where the glazing complements the rest of the interior design.
The seven story high Institute of Life Science was opened earlier this year, and students at the university now have a new location for their studies, a building that is modern, contemporary and meets all regulations for fire safety and security.

Megger measures low resistance anywhere!
Story
Equally at home in the laboratory, the workshop or in the field, on the bench or on the ground, Megger´s new heavy duty DLRO10HD low resistance ohmmeter combines rugged construction with accuracy and ease of use. It features an internal rechargeable battery and can also operate from a mains supply, even if the battery is completely flat.

Tough work horse
Equally at home in the laboratory, the workshop or in the field, on the bench or on the ground, Megger´s new heavy duty DLRO10HD low resistance ohmmeter combines rugged construction with accuracy and ease of use. It features an internal rechargeable battery and can also operate from a mains supply, even if the battery is completely flat. Like all models in the DLRO10 range, the DLRO10HD, when used with optional terminal insulating test leads, is rated CATIII, 300 V in line with IEC61010.
This versatile new test set is built into a tough but easy–to–carry case that provides an IP65 ingress protection rating when closed and an IP54 rating when the instrument is in use and operating from battery power.
Easy to use with gloved hand
The instrument´s rotary switch controls are convenient to operate even with gloved hands, and it incorporates a large backlit liquid crystal display that can be easily read from a considerable distance.
With 0.1 µO resolution, 0.2% basic accuracy, and a dedicated mode for use with inductive loads, the DLRO10HD is ideal for applications as diverse as checking the integrity of welded joints and verifying winding resistance in large motors and transformers.
To provide maximum versatility, this innovative test set not only features high compliance but also offers user–selectable high or low power ranges. The high power < 25 W ranges (measuring up to 250 mO at 10 A , or 2.5 O at 1 A) are ideal for heating a weakness or charging inductive loads. The low power ranges are power limited to 250 mW for applications where it is desirable to avoid heating the item under test.
Choice of test modes
The instrument offers a choice of five test modes. In normal mode, the test is initiated by pressing the “test” button. The instrument verifies continuity of all four connections, and then applies the test current in both forward and reverse directions before displaying the result. In automatic mode, the test starts as soon as the probes make contact with the item under test.
Automatic unidirectional mode is the same as automatic mode, but the test current is applied in one direction only. This reduces the testing time, but thermal EMFs from contact between dissimilar metals may reduce the accuracy of the results.
Continuous mode makes repeated measurements at three–second intervals on the same sample. Inductive mode is, as the name suggests, optimised for tests on motors, transformers and other inductive loads, supplying a full 10 Amps for 60 up to seconds.
DLRO10HD heavy–duty low resistance ohmmeters from Megger are supplied, as standard, with a set of test leads fitted with high–quality duplex hand spikes featuring lights to remotely indicate when a test is complete or inadvertent connection to live supply. Test leads with Kelvin clips are also available as an option.

Ability Fan Coil Units for BREEAM ‘Excellent' Severn Trent Operations Centre
Story
The new £60 million flagship operations centre of Severn Trent Water, built by BAM Construct UK, has recently been opened for business in St. Johns Street, Coventry. The prestigious 170,000 ft2 complex, which features air conditioning fan coil units manufactured by Ability Projects Ltd, will eventually house around 1700 staff.
Ability Projects supplied a variety of 2 pipe cooling only horizontal ceiling recessed EC-DC VE”70 and vertical EVOVERT fan coil units to the general office accommodation areas with capacities between 1.68 and 6.3kWat an NR35 operational noise environment of 35 Pascals resistance. The vertical units, installed in a number of meeting rooms, are all fitted with special rectangular spigots and some also have special split access panels for easy maintenance. EC-DC Evolution fan coils are state of the art units offering reductions in electrical input of 75% and above compared to similar capacity AC driven equivalents plus infinite speed control and minimal heat generation.
Considered to be one of the most significant commercial projects in the region, the highly energy efficient building features a range of advanced technologies including thermal adaptive cooling, biomass boilers, photovoltaic panels, solar panels, underfloor displacement ventilation and rainwater harvesting. Designed to BREEAM ‘Excellent’ standards, the centre will enable Severn Trent Water to close a number of its less carbon and cost efficient buildings. The 38 metre high unit in fact, is said to possess one of the lowest carbon footprints for any UK commercial office building. Contractors for the project were Balfour Beatty Engineering Services.

Low down from Thorn
Story
The Lopak II is a welcome addition to Thorn’s LumExpress contractor range, providing a sleek low bay for factories, warehouses, sports halls and DIY outlets all in one box. Taking either HST or HIT (250W/400W) lamps it provides 20 per cent more light than its predecessor, is easy to install, has low running costs, and offers years of reliable performance.
By mounting the lamp horizontally, and siting the gear at one end of the fitting, the overall depth is kept to 163mm, making it suitable for ceilings as low as five metres and more portable for the installer and stockist. A quick-fix bracket and detachable gear tray simplifies electrical connection and maintenance.
Optional ‘tool less’ accessories include a wire guard, plastic cover and rack reflector and added safety comes via a timed ignitor and integrated auxiliary lamp options.
With Lopak II the economies of lower energy consumption and fewer fittings to be bought and maintained become available to users who want a simple, inexpensive but compact discharge luminaire.

Fakro roof windows thwart attempted burglary
Story



In terms of security a product has to be tested to virtual destruction to determine whether it truly performs. Even so, the ultimate proof is a real life situation and in the case of FAKRO’s topSafe® system the results of an attempted burglary speak for themselves.** 3 FTP-V windows in conservation style were targeted because views of the roof were obscured from the ground. The burglars were doubtless aware of the ease with which many well known roof windows can be opened but attempts in this case met with total failure despite the evident use of a crowbar. Though the damage was clearly significant, repair was possible as FAKRO’s windows are all designed to be broken down for ultimate recycling.
The patented, topSafe® system is not used by any other manufacturer and provides the highest standard of security and safety currently available as standard (Class 3 – EN 13049). It employs a combination of additional steel reinforcement built into the lower part of the sash, improved lock security and longer screws driven in at an angle to prevent hinges being ruptured. U.K. Sales Director Phil Adams commented, “topSafe enables the window sash to withstand even the weight of an individual jumping on it. As a result, a number of FAKRO windows achieve EN13049 Class 4 when many competitors’ products barely meet basic standards of lock security”.

Micronics – New Product Release
Story
U1000 – Permanent/fixed clamp-on flow metering solution
Clamp-on to a New alternative to cutting pipes and mechanical meters from Micronics for significant installation savings and simple, accurate flow measurement from outside the pipe!
Sub-metering of hot and chilled water services to monitor, control and manage water and energy consumption is an area of growing demand in building services and energy management. But the installation process including system drain down, pipe cutting etc has always been a significant cost and barrier to wider application of sub-metering. At last a solution from the longest established manufacturer of clamp-on, ultrasonic meters has arrived, the U1000 from Micronics. Building on their many years of experience and success in this area, Micronics has now developed a cost-engineered, factory configured water flow measurement solution to facilitate the wider use of water sub-metering and flow measurement for energy monitoring.
The U1000 is a simple out of the box, onto the pipe meter or flow measurement solution with no programming or specialist engineering required! Simply tell Micronics your pipe size and they will send you a factory configured meter, ready to clamp-on and produce flow information in minutes. All you have to do is clamp the unit to the pipe, release the sensor clamps, connect power and enter the pipe size. Yes it really is that simple because Micronics have listened and simple installation is a key design feature. Another cost-effective alternative to expensive in-line meter installation from Micronics, plus dry servicing, providing minimum downtime and maximum availability!
The U1000 is a transit time ultrasonic flow meter designed to work with clamp-on transducers, to provide accurate measurement of liquid flowing within a closed pipe, without the need for any mechanical parts to be inserted through the pipe wall or to protrude into the flow system. It takes just a few minutes to install and there is no need to shut down flow or drain the system!
So if you need a stand-alone water meter or sub-metering of hot and chilled water services as part of your aM&T or BEM’s system the U1000 should be a must consider solution.
